1. The Sweat Session: How Exercise Boosts Blood Flow and Skin Health
Imagine your body as a city, and your blood vessels as the bustling streets. When you hit the treadmill or lift weights, you’re essentially creating a traffic jam of oxygen-rich blood flowing to your skin. This surge of blood not only gives your complexion a healthy flush but also helps nourish your skin cells, making them plumper and more radiant. Plus, increased blood flow means better waste removal from your skin, which can help reduce acne and other blemishes. So, next time you’re sweating buckets, remember you’re doing your skin a solid. 🚗💦
2. The Anti-Aging Workout: Can Exercise Really Turn Back Time?
Time to face the facts: aging is inevitable. But can exercise slow down the clock? Absolutely! Regular physical activity has been shown to increase collagen production, which is the protein responsible for keeping your skin firm and elastic. In essence, exercise acts like a natural Botox, helping to reduce fine lines and wrinkles. So, while you may not turn back time completely, you can certainly look younger and feel better. 3. The Holistic Glow: Beyond Skin, How Fitness Enhances Your Overall Appearance
It’s not just about the skin. Exercise has a domino effect on your entire body. Improved muscle tone, better posture, and increased energy levels can all contribute to a more confident and vibrant appearance. Plus, the mental health benefits of exercise—reduced stress, improved mood, and better sleep—can do wonders for your overall well-being, which often translates to a brighter, more energetic look. 4. The Practical Tips: Crafting a Routine for Maximum Beauty Benefits
Now that you know the perks, how do you get started? Here are a few tips to ensure you’re getting the most out of your workout for your skin:
- Hydrate: Drink plenty of water before, during, and after your workout to keep your skin hydrated and flush out toxins.
- Cleanse: Always wash your face before and after exercising to remove sweat and prevent clogged pores.
- Sunscreen: If you’re working out outdoors, don’t forget to apply sunscreen to protect your skin from harmful UV rays.
